浏览器看到的信息 怎么回传给arduino啊?
{:soso_e103:} 浏览器看到的信息,就是模拟口的读数。。。不需要传回arduino吧~~这些都是arduino传给浏览器的。 弘毅 发表于 2012-1-5 19:24 static/image/common/back.gif
浏览器看到的信息,就是模拟口的读数。。。不需要传回arduino吧~~这些都是arduino传给浏览 ...
我怎么感觉上面的朋友提问的是:要通过Arduino来与上位机的IE通信的那。 照着上面写的编译报错:
In file included from F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Ethernet.h:5,
from WebServer.cpp:7:
F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Client.h:22: error: conflicting return type specified for 'virtual void Client::write(uint8_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\hardware\arduino\cores\arduino/Print.h:48: error: overriding 'virtual size_t Print::write(uint8_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Client.h:24: error: conflicting return type specified for 'virtual void Client::write(const uint8_t*, size_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\hardware\arduino\cores\arduino/Print.h:50: error: overriding 'virtual size_t Print::write(const uint8_t*, size_t)'
In file included from F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Ethernet.h:6,
from WebServer.cpp:7:
F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Server.h:16: error: conflicting return type specified for 'virtual void Server::write(uint8_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\hardware\arduino\cores\arduino/Print.h:48: error: overriding 'virtual size_t Print::write(uint8_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\libraries\ENC28J60/Server.h:18: error: conflicting return type specified for 'virtual void Server::write(const uint8_t*, size_t)'
F:\arduino\arduino-1.0-windows\arduino-1.0\hardware\arduino\cores\arduino/Print.h:50: error: overriding 'virtual size_t Print::write(const uint8_t*, size_t)'什么原因 wubo19842008 发表于 2012-2-8 22:01 static/image/common/back.gif
照着上面写的编译报错:什么原因
自己找到问题了,LZ给的lib是0022版本的ide下可用,升级到最新的1.0版本有些库变了,要用最新的enc28j60的lib,
下载地址
https://github.com/turicas/Ethernet_ENC28J60 为什么我用ENC28J60模块的时候无法用浏览器访问,但是能在命令窗口下PING出来 东西不错,就是不知道价格怎么样?
RE: arduino学习笔记26 - ENC28J60以太网模块实验
smallzzy 发表于 2011-12-10 19:20 static/image/common/back.gif如果有密码,如何让程序自动输入
需要查看一下用户名或密码的表单代码,然后做个隐含域,就可以自动提交密码了。 请问如何用28j60和arduino读取网页信息呢?库里面自带的那个webclient跑不通。。 rotate 发表于 2012-3-13 13:51 static/image/common/back.gif
请问如何用28j60和arduino读取网页信息呢?库里面自带的那个webclient跑不通。。
google上面搜搜其他ENC28J60的库~~~看看有没有可以实现这个功能的 隐含域怎么做呢?
RE: arduino学习笔记26 - ENC28J60以太网模块实验
本帖最后由 thomas 于 2012-3-13 22:41 编辑smallzzy 发表于 2012-3-13 21:49 static/image/common/back.gif
隐含域怎么做呢?
form中添加
<input type=hidden name=password value='password string'>
name是密码域的变量,value是密码内容,这样密码认证就自动通过了。 很好的教程,不过最开始的使用自制的ATMEGA8最小系统的时候,代码太长,下载失败,换成UNO的板后就成功了。 请教一下,int口一定要接PIN2么?能不能改成别的数字口?
还有这个模块直接接5V的I/O木有问题么 本帖最后由 thomas 于 2012-4-14 11:17 编辑
我用的板子是最老的简易板,有电压选择跳线,但输入没有缓冲芯片,发热厉害容易挂。说明书说能 容忍5v电压,还是觉得不靠谱。有种带缓冲74芯片的,不知是不是好些。
口随便改吧。,库里有配置,挺不明显。这板子兼容性太差了,前几天用新库才调通。 网口通讯有什么用处,举个例哦.